classesforchildrenadults in Shrewsbury, MA

  1. Holliston Villaris Self Defense Center 1570 Washington St HollistonMA01746 (508) 429-8855 15.7 mi
  2. Lexington School Of Ballet 1403 Massachusetts Ave Ste 2 LexingtonMA02420 (781) 863-8484 27.3 mi
  3. One Step Beyond Martial Arts 1231 Hyde Park Ave Hyde ParkMA02136 (617) 364-9563 30.2 mi
  4. One Step Beyond Martial Arts Training Center
    1231 Hyde Park Ave Hyde ParkMA02136 (617) 364-9563 30.3 mi
  5. Amherst Martial Arts 48 N Pleasant St Bsmt 1 AmherstMA01002 (413) 256-0300 41.6 mi